#219ef2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#219ef2 is composed of 12.9% red, 62%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.4% cyan, 34.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 204.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 53.9%. #219ef2 color hex could be obtained by blending #42ffff with #003de5.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#219ef2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#219ef2 has RGB values of R:33, G:158,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 2203378.

Shades and Tints of #219ef2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#edf7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#219ef2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848a8f is the less saturated color, while #18a0fb is the most saturated one.
